About Shea Butter PEG-12 Dimethicone Esters

Shea Butter PEG-12 Dimethicone Esters are esters containing parts derived from an acid and an alcohol.[1] The number 12 in the name indicates the average number of added ethylene oxide units; within the same basic structure, changes in this number may affect water dispersibility, viscosity, and spreadability of the formula. In cosmetics, they are used to reduce tangling and rough feel in hair, leaving it smooth and manageable.[1]
